<description>The DNS server dnsmasq was updated to fix one security issue and one non-security bug.
The following vulnerability was fixed:
* CVE-2015-3294: A remote unauthenticated attacker could have caused a denial of service (DoS) or read heap memory, potentially disclosing information such as performed DNS queries or encryption keys. (bsc#928867)
The following bug was fixed:
* bsc#923144: When answer to an upstream query is a CNAME pointing to an A/AAAA record which is present locally (/etc/hosts), allow caching when the upstream and local A/AAAA records have the same value.
